Wenlian Lu is affiliated with Fudan University in China and has contributed extensively to research in computer science and engineering. Their work spans multiple subfields including computer networks and communications, cognitive neuroscience, artificial intelligence, statistical and nonlinear physics, and control and systems engineering.
The scientist's research topics focus primarily on neural networks stability and synchronization, neural dynamics and brain function, nonlinear dynamics and pattern formation, distributed control of multi-agent systems, advanced memory and neural computing, neural networks and applications, and opinion dynamics and social influence.
Frequent co-authors include Jianfeng Feng, Tianping Chen, Yujuan Han, Longbin Zeng, and Yingying Lang.
Wenlian Lu has published papers in a variety of venues. The most frequent publication outlets are arXiv (Cornell University), Neurocomputing, Neural Networks, National Science Review, and Mathematics.
